Local Schools Visit the Supreme Boats Factory Manufacturing Day

Students from five local schools get a behind-the-scenes look at the Supreme factory.

MERCED, CA (October 4, 2019) – The Supreme Boats factory was a buzz with excitement today as over 50 students from Merced Scholars Charter School, Delhi High School, Delhi Middle School, Stone Ridge Christian School, and Atwater Valley Community School toured the manufacturing facility as a part of Manufacturing Day. Manufacturing Day is a national event that’s been put on for several years to bring attention to manufacturing and the opportunities that it presents to students.

This year’s group was particularly engaged as students got an overview of the entire boat building process from the ground up. After the event one student said, “It was really cool to see how hard these guys work and how much they do behind the scenes. I could really see myself doing something like this when I graduate.”

Taylor Alandzes, Student Advocate at Atwater Valley Community School said, “Our school was delighted to be a part of Supreme’s Manufacturing Day. Our kids are not frequently afforded opportunities like this and to be one of the schools asked to participate was an honor,”

When asked about manufacturing day Bill Yeargin, Correct Craft’s President and CEO stated, “Every year our team gets excited to host students for Manufacturing Day. Teaching students about the many opportunities manufacturing has to offer while showing them how much we believe in all our products is really rewarding.” Yeargin added, “Students who visited our companies were able to increase their knowledge about the marine industry and hear about Correct Craft’s culture of ‘Making Life Better!’”

Manufacturing Day represents many core values held close at Supreme Boats, after all, 90% of our factory employees physically work on every boat that leaves the facility. Manufacturing affords individuals economic opportunities while allowing them to pour into their communities, this of course falls directly within Supreme’s charge to make lives better.

About Correct Craft: Celebrating 94 years of excellence in the marine industry, Correct Craft is a Florida-based company with global operations. Focused on “Making Life Better,” the Correct Craft family includes Nautique, Centurion, Supreme, Bass Cat, Yar-Craft, SeaArk, Parker, and Bryant boat companies, Pleasurecraft Marine Engine Group, Watershed Innovation and Aktion Parks.
